On Gull Lake<\/h3>\n

Parkland Beach is situated on the northern shore of Gull Lake surrounded by woodland and rolling hills. Nearby communities offer, shopping, recreation, schools, churches, and restaurants. Parkland Beach is just 15 minutes from Rimbey, 20 minutes from Bentley, and thirty minutes from Ponoka, Lacombe, and Red Deer.<\/p>\n

The Summer Village of Parkland Beach was incorporated in 1984. Open year-round to a mix of permanent residents and summer cottagers, Parkland Beach is home to population of 153 permanent residents (2016 Census) living in 68 of its 213 total private dwellings.<\/p>\n

The Summer Village of Parkland Beach spans a land area of 0.95 square kilometers. The Summer Village is governed by a three-member council as well as a chief administrative officer that oversees the day-to-day running of the Summer Village.<\/p>\n

Our Community Commitment<\/h3>\n

In partnership with dedicated community members, Parkland Beach is committed to enhancements of the Summer Village lakefront and amenities.<\/p>\n

The beach has a playground, boat launch, washrooms, adult exercise equipment, nature signs and walking trails.<\/p>\n

The Summer Village Hall facility has a seating capacity of 50 people indoors with a small kitchen and accessible washroom. An outdoor patio area may also be used in summer weather, with BBQ grills available.\u00a0 It is a great location for special occasions and family gatherings.<\/p>\n

A ball diamond is located next to the Summer Village Hall.<\/p>\n

Clear Water and Sandy Beaches<\/h3>\n

The lake is a popular destination for recreation, yet it is rarely crowded. Gull Lake is one of the only Alberta lakes that uses a pumping station, with water diverted from the Blindman River, to maintain water levels. This ensures the long-term health of the lake and consistent water levels for recreation. In the summer, residents and visitors can look forward to long days of water activities, fishing, sun-tanning, barbecuing, and pelican watching. The fun doesn\u2019t stop when it snows; Gull Lake is known for its excellent ice-fishing. A skating rink is also cleared\u00a0and maintained each winter.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"
